How to estimate PV potential?
Utilization of Azimuth, Tilt and PV related parameters for various PV studies. PV potential estimation can be carried out with many different approaches based on 2D, 2.5D and 3D data. However, regardless of the method utilized, area, azimuth and tilt angles of the roof surfaces must be considered to make an accurate PV potential estimation.

Is span a good tool for PV potential estimation?
An important gap in the literature is filled by the SPAN, which employs a novel technique for PV potential estimation and is implemented as a lightweight, freely available, and intuitive QGIS plugin, making it accessible to researchers, students, and professionals alike.

How many solar radiation databases can be used for photovoltaic potential estimation?
Users can use four different solar radiation databases for photovoltaic potential estimation. PVGIS-SARAH2 is a 0.05° × 0.05° spatial resolution database produced by The Satellite Application Facility on Climate Monitoring (CM-SAF) to replace SARAH-1 (PVGIS-SARAH), covering Europe, Africa, most of Asia, and parts of South America.
